#42b259 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#42b259 is composed of 25.9% red, 69.8%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 50%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 132.3 degrees, a saturation of 45.9% and a lightness of 47.8%. #42b259 color hex could be obtained by blending #84ffb2 with #006500.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#42b259 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#42b259 has RGB values of R:66, G:178,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0, Y:0.5,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 4371033.

Hex triplet 42b259 #42b259
RGB Decimal 66, 178, 89 rgb(66,178,89)
RGB Percent 25.9, 69.8, 34.9 rgb(25.9%,69.8%,34.9%)
CMYK 63, 0, 50, 30
HSL 132.3°, 45.9, 47.8 hsl(132.3,45.9%,47.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 132.3°, 62.9, 69.8
Web Safe 339966 #339966
CIE-LAB 64.739, -50.769, 36.126
XYZ 19.969, 33.719, 14.907
xyY 0.291, 0.492, 33.719
CIE-LCH 64.739, 62.31, 144.566
CIE-LUV 64.739, -48.662, 53.548
Hunter-Lab 58.068, -40.233, 25.427
Binary 01000010, 10110010, 01011001

Shades and Tints of #42b259

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020603 is the darkest color, while #f7fcf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#42b259

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#718375 is the less saturated color, while #00f432 is the most saturated one.
